Chapter 102: Bathing in Color
Jun Qiyu stood at the door for a while. Because Qi Miao had instructed him that he was not suited for the blinding sunlight, it was better for him to first adapt to the dim moonlight. So, he had come out for a walk, removed the blindfold, and enjoyed the night for a while.
Just as he was retying the cloth to cover his eyes, he heard a woman clumsily speaking to him, apologizing.
Jun Qiyu squinted, then remembered that this was the beauty that Governor Xu had presented to him.
However, this beauty seemed absent-minded. He had only asked her who she was, and she immediately burst into tears, as if she had suffered some great injustice.
“How odd.”
If this had been in the past, when Jun Qiyu’s temper was worse, he would have had someone drag her away. But after spending time with Song Liqing, his patience had improved, and he had become much more easygoing in his interactions with others.
Moreover, he was in a good mood these days, so he didn’t want to press the matter further.
“Oh, you’re Hu Yue’er,” Jun Qiyu said. “Sorry, I can’t see.”
Sorry…
Hu Yue’er froze in place.
The crown prince actually apologized to her! This was an immense honor!
In Hu Yue’er’s eyes, the crown prince was like a god who always had his way. Whatever he did was right, and there was no need for him to apologize to anyone. Moreover, everyone knew that Jun Qiyu had a bad temper, and one had to be extremely careful around him. A single mistake could lead to his wrath.
“It’s fine… it’s nothing, Your Highness.”
Her eyes welled up. The crown prince not only remembered her, but also showed such kindness.
Jun Qiyu then asked, “These days, have you been going to Wangqing Tower?”
“Ah, yes,” Hu Yue’er replied honestly.
“Mm… has Liqing said anything to you?”
Jun Qiyu wasn’t gossiping. He was just curious about what Song Liqing was thinking.
Knowing oneself and one’s enemy leads to victory in every battle.
Since Song Liqing refused to open up to him, Jun Qiyu had no choice but to inquire indirectly.
“What do you mean?” Hu Yue’er asked, confused.
“Anything. His likes, thoughts, or if he has mentioned someone he likes, or his lover…”
Jun Qiyu felt a bit awkward. Wasn’t this too petty of him?
The intelligent and witty Hu Yue’er understood.
The crown prince had just captured the person and was now trying to gain his favor.
Hu Yue’er’s mind spun. How could she let this fool steal the spotlight?
“Yes, he often stands at Wangqing Tower, looking in the northwest direction, thinking of his lover.”
“Oh? Really? He even told you this? He said the words ‘lover’ himself?”
Jun Qiyu wasn’t entirely convinced, but it was true that Song Liqing often thought about his brother, Xing Xu.
Lover or not, it sounded like nonsense.
“Yes, I am always straightforward and sincere with others. He trusts me, that’s why he told me. Otherwise, how would I know he was once married? Since Your Highness asked, I will tell others his secret. He just can’t forget the past. Please don’t blame him.”
Jun Qiyu remained silent, clearly annoyed with the fool.
Hu Yue’er fanned herself and said, “Sigh… He has tried several times to leave Kirin Manor, just to meet with his lover. Why not just… let him be?”
“What do you know?”
Jun Qiyu snorted, clearly irritated. Hu Yue’er, afraid of being implicated, quickly fell silent.
Jun Qiyu turned and walked away, most likely heading to Wangqing Tower to settle the matter.
“Your Highness, you’re not in the best condition. Let me help you,” Hu Yue’er offered.
She wanted to watch the drama unfold. She was curious to see how the crown prince would deal with that fool.
“No need, I’m more familiar with Kirin Manor than you are.”
Jun Qiyu refused, walking arrogantly. He knew every brick and tile of Kirin Manor, and now that he could see through the gaps, he could navigate it just fine.
When Jun Qiyu knocked on the door, the maid had already prepared hot water, and Song Liqing was getting ready to bathe, eager to relax after his exhausting escapes. His legs were sore, and he planned to soak in the water to rejuvenate himself.
“Liqing, are you asleep?”
“No…”
Song Liqing answered honestly, but then realized he didn’t want to see him. Every time Jun Qiyu came, they’d be stuck talking for ages and couldn’t get rid of him, so he changed his answer.
“I’m asleep!”
But it was too late. Jun Qiyu had already slipped in through the gap in the door.
Hearing the noise, Song Liqing quickly pulled up the half-removed clothes.
“Don’t come in, I’m bathing.”
Jun Qiyu peeked his head around, but the screen blocked his view.
“It’s fine, we don’t need to stand on ceremony.” Jun Qiyu added in his heart, “It’s not like I’ve never seen you before.”
But now, it felt so difficult to see him. Jun Qiyu lamented internally.
“Ah, what are you doing?”
Seeing Jun Qiyu making his way in, Song Liqing blocked him.
“I… I’ll help you wash your back. Your back injuries aren’t healed, right? It must be difficult for you to wash.”
Jun Qiyu casually came up with an excuse.
“No need.”
Song Liqing felt uncomfortable. Undressing in front of Jun Qiyu felt extremely unsafe.
“Yes, there is a need.”
Jun Qiyu insisted on squeezing in, but Song Liqing firmly blocked him.
“Liqing, are you afraid of me seeing you? I’m blind now. Even if you let me see, I wouldn’t be able to. Hm? What’s that smell? You haven’t had your back rubbed for days, have you? Your body must be sore. If you really don’t want me to, I’ll call a maid to do it.”
Jun Qiyu was dead set on this. Song Liqing liked cleanliness, so he wouldn’t tolerate being called smelly.
Sure enough, Song Liqing immediately sniffed his robe. It didn’t smell sour, but books said one couldn’t smell their own odor.
Jun Qiyu wasn’t entirely wrong. Anyway, he was blind now.
Having a girl rub his back wasn’t as good as letting Jun Qiyu do it.
In the past, he hadn’t even let Xiao Di serve him in the bath.
Thinking this, Song Liqing weakened his resistance.
Jun Qiyu easily squeezed in. As Song Liqing saw him fumbling about, his discomfort lessened.
“Have you taken off your clothes?” Jun Qiyu asked as he stood there. “Do you want me to help?”
“I’ll do it myself.”
Song Liqing still felt awkward, so he turned around and began to slowly undress.
Jun Qiyu stood motionless. From the gap in the screen, his view was limited. He could only see Song Liqing’s delicate ankles. Jun Qiyu’s heart itched, and he craned his neck to catch a glimpse of the smooth calf.
Before he could take a closer look, Song Liqing had already stepped into the bath, hiding beneath the warm water.
Jun Qiyu couldn’t help but feel regret.
“Aren’t you going to let me wash your back? Why are you still standing there?” Song Liqing asked, looking back.
“Oh, coming, coming.”
Jun Qiyu hurried over. Song Liqing handed him a gourd ladle, and Jun Qiyu scooped up some hot water, gently wetting Song Liqing’s black hair.
Jun Qiyu’s vision was already limited, and the hot steam made it even more difficult to see. Everything around him was blurry. The only thing clear was Song Liqing’s smooth back, which, in the candlelight, seemed to emit a faint, pure glow.
